On Tue, 2005-02-08 at 10:54, dr brian crowley wrote:
> Just had a bereaved relative asking for a freedom from infection certificate
> relating to the deceased so the body can be shipped over to Ireland.

Not unreasonable - countries want to know that the deceased didn't die
of Anthrax, Smallpox, Tuberculosis, Ebola etc.

They are not, I venture to suggest, asking for a certificate of freedom
from bacteria or viruses, just a note to say they don't need to receive
in a level 4 containment facility a corpse that should have been covered
in quicklime and then incinerated as son as possible.
